Irene went to Naisamula village to teach about maternal child and infant health basically teach about the risks,causes of death, gender roles,and importance of antenatal care. The meeting started with a word from the chairman who welcomed everyone, thanked them for coming back early from the garden to attend the health lesson, taking the initiative to pass on information to the other members about the meetings. He then welcomed Irene to say a word to the members. Irene thanked the chairman for the opportunity given, thanked members for turning up for the meeting though time keeping is still a challenge,and then she asked members to remind her what was studied in the previous lesson,she told the members that they were going to talk about maternal, child and infant health. She asked members the meaning of maternal,infant and child health and with several trials and suggestions Irene added that its Improving the wellbeing of mothers, infants, and children with a goal for the African countries wellbeing, it also determines the health of the next generation and can help predict future public challenges for the families, communities and the healthcare system. Irene further explained the major risks and causes of death in mothers,infants and children some of which included hemorrhage, sepsis, malnutrition,chronic illnesses among others. Then they also discussed the gender roles, explaining what needs should be met for the well-being of the mother, children and infants and what should be prepared when getting ready for labor. The meeting was cut short because it started raining so we were not able to continue with the other discussion and decided to postpone it for the next meeting.
